EA servers brought down by hacker group

Hacking collective called Poodlecorp claims responsibility for DDoS attack.

Just mere hours after the grand opening of the Battlefield 1 beta, the servers were hit by a DDoS attack, and was affecting not only the beta, but many other EA online services as well. The company was quick to acknowledge til outage via their official Twitter, and equally fast was the reveal of the perpetrator.

Hacking collective Poodlecorp quickly claimed responsibility for the hack via their Twitter, saying:

"We are responsible for the downtime of @EA & @Battlefield #PoodleCorp"

This is the same group hackers who recently claimed responsibility for hacking Grand Theft Auto Online servers, as well as Battle.net. As always, it's difficult to confirm whether it's true or not.
